标题:构建高效可靠的分布式存储服务器
一、引言
随着信息技术的飞速发展,数据量呈爆炸式增长,对数据存储的需求也越来越高,传统的集中式存储服务器已经难以满足大规模数据存储和高并发访问的要求,分布式存储服务器作为一种新兴的存储技术,具有高可靠性、高扩展性、高性能等优点,逐渐成为数据存储领域的主流选择,本文将介绍分布式存储服务器的基本概念、架构、优势以及搭建方法。
二、分布式存储服务器的基本概念
分布式存储服务器是将数据分散存储在多个节点上的存储系统,每个节点都可以独立地存储和管理数据,同时通过网络连接在一起,形成一个统一的存储池,分布式存储服务器可以根据需要动态地增加或减少节点,实现存储容量的扩展和性能的提升。
三、分布式存储服务器的架构
分布式存储服务器的架构通常包括客户端、元数据服务器、数据存储节点和网络通信层,客户端是用户与分布式存储服务器交互的接口,负责上传、下载和查询数据,元数据服务器负责管理分布式存储服务器的元数据,包括文件系统、目录结构、数据块位置等,数据存储节点负责存储实际的数据块,并提供数据的读写服务,网络通信层负责客户端、元数据服务器和数据存储节点之间的网络通信。
四、分布式存储服务器的优势
1、高可靠性:分布式存储服务器将数据分散存储在多个节点上,当某个节点出现故障时,其他节点可以继续提供服务,保证数据的可用性。
2、高扩展性:分布式存储服务器可以根据需要动态地增加或减少节点,实现存储容量的扩展和性能的提升。
3、高性能:分布式存储服务器可以通过并行读写多个数据块,提高数据的读写速度。
4、数据冗余:分布式存储服务器可以通过数据冗余技术,保证数据的安全性和可靠性。
5、成本低:分布式存储服务器可以利用普通的服务器和存储设备,降低存储成本。
五、分布式存储服务器的搭建方法
1、选择合适的分布式存储服务器软件:目前市面上有很多分布式存储服务器软件,如 Ceph、GlusterFS、Hadoop HDFS 等,用户可以根据自己的需求和实际情况选择合适的软件。
2、搭建分布式存储服务器环境:用户需要搭建一个适合分布式存储服务器运行的环境,包括操作系统、网络环境、存储设备等。
3、安装和配置分布式存储服务器软件:用户需要按照软件的安装文档,安装和配置分布式存储服务器软件。
4、创建分布式存储池:用户需要创建一个分布式存储池,将存储设备加入到存储池中。
5、创建文件系统和目录结构:用户需要在分布式存储池中创建文件系统和目录结构,用于存储数据。
6、上传和下载数据:用户可以通过客户端将数据上传到分布式存储服务器中,也可以从分布式存储服务器中下载数据。
六、结论
分布式存储服务器作为一种新兴的存储技术,具有高可靠性、高扩展性、高性能等优点,逐渐成为数据存储领域的主流选择,本文介绍了分布式存储服务器的基本概念、架构、优势以及搭建方法,希望对读者有所帮助。
评论列表